Licensed under the Elastic License * 2.0 and the Server Side Public License, v 1; you may not use this file except * in compliance with, at your election, the Elastic License 2.0 or the Server * Side Public License, v 1. */ import { useEffect, useState, useRef } from 'react'; import { matchContainer } from './match_container'; /** * React hook that subscribes to CSS container query changes. * * For this to work: * - a proper container (an element with e.g. `container-type: inline-size`) is needed, and * - the container MUST to be a parent of the element being observed * * @param containerCondition - A CSS `<container-condition>` string, e.g. `(width > 400px)` or `(min-width: 600px)` * @param name - Optional container name, e.g. `sidebar` * @returns An object containing: * - `ref`: A ref to attach to the container element * - `matches`: `true` if the container matches the condition, `false` otherwise * * @example * ```tsx * const { ref, matches } = useEuiContainerQuery('(width > 400px)'); * return <div ref={ref}>{matches ? 'Wide' : 'Narrow'}</div>; * ``` * * @see {@link https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/CSS/Reference/At-rules/@container | MDN: @container} * @beta */ export function useEuiContainerQuery(containerCondition, name) { var containerQueryString = name ? "".concat(name, " ").concat(containerCondition) : containerCondition; var ref = useRef(null); var _useState = useState(false), _useState2 = _slicedToArray(_useState, 2), matches = _useState2[0], setMatches = _useState2[1]; useEffect(function () { if (!ref.current) return; var queryList = matchContainer(ref.current, containerQueryString); var handleChange = function handleChange() { setMatches(queryList.matches); }; setMatches(queryList.matches); queryList.addEventListener('change', handleChange); return function () { queryList.removeEventListener('change', handleChange); queryList.dispose(); }; }, [ref, containerQueryString]); return { ref: ref, matches: matches }; }
